Background
The cable connector is also called a cable head. After the cable is laid, the sections of the cable must be connected together in order to form a continuous line, and these connections are called cable connectors. The cable joints at the middle of the cable run are called intermediate joints and the cable joints at the two ends of the run are called termination joints. The cable joint is used for locking and fixing incoming and outgoing lines, plays a role in water resistance, dust resistance and vibration resistance, and has the main functions of enabling the lines to be smooth, enabling the cables to be kept sealed, ensuring the insulation grade at the cable joint and enabling the cable joint to operate safely and reliably. If the sealing is poor, not only oil leakage causes oil-impregnated paper to dry up, but also moisture invades into the cable, so that the insulating property of the cable is reduced.
The existing mineral insulated cable joint has poor electrical insulation performance, so that the safety coefficient of the cable in the connection use process is low, and the cable has great limitation.

Referring to fig. 1-4, the present invention provides an embodiment: the utility model provides a fireproof cable joint, includes loading board 3, and the inside of loading board 3 is provided with interface channel 9, and interface channel 9's internally mounted has low smoke and zero halogen sheath 1, and low smoke and zero halogen sheath 1's inside is provided with insulating sheath 5, and insulating sheath 5 and low smoke and zero halogen sheath 1's clearance department are provided with fireproof mud 6, and insulating sheath 5's internally mounted has cable joint.
Further, insulating sheath 5 is provided with two, and the one end of two insulating sheath 5 all is provided with ring flange 7, and two insulating sheath 5 pass through 8 fixed connection of connecting bolt of installation on the ring flange 7, and two insulating sheath 5 that set up play the effect of parcel insulated cable joint, and ring flange 7 that the one end of two insulating sheath 5 all set up plays the effect of the sealed butt joint of two insulating sheath 5 of being convenient for.
Further, all be provided with mounting groove 15 on the inner wall of two ring flanges 7, the inside of mounting groove 15 is provided with seal ring 16, and seal ring 16 is located the joint gap department of two ring flanges 7, and the mounting groove 15 that all sets up on the inner wall of two ring flanges 7 plays the effect of the installation of being convenient for seal ring 16, and seal ring 16 that the inside of mounting groove 15 set up plays the effect of two ring flanges 7 joint gap of sealing.
Further, be provided with a plurality of pressure spring 11 on the inner wall of interface channel 9, and a plurality of pressure spring 11 is about interface channel 9's central point symmetric distribution, pressure spring 11's one end is provided with damping supporting seat 10, and damping supporting seat 10 and interface channel 9's inner wall fixed connection, pressure spring 11's the other end is provided with contact plate 12, and contact plate 12 closely laminates with low smoke and zero halogen sheath 1's outer wall, a plurality of pressure spring 11 that sets up on interface channel 9's the inner wall plays the effect of compressing tightly installation to low smoke and zero halogen sheath 1, damping supporting seat 10 that pressure spring 11's one end set up plays the effect that supplementary pressure spring 11 compressed tightly.
Further, the lower extreme of loading board 3 is provided with base 4, and the lower extreme of base 4 is provided with bottom plate 13, and the inside of bottom plate 13 is provided with four mounting holes 14, and mounting hole 14 and bottom plate 13 structure as an organic whole, and base 4 that the lower extreme of loading board 3 set up plays the effect of supporting loading board 3, and bottom plate 13 that the lower extreme of base 4 set up plays the effect of the loading board 3 installation of being convenient for.
Further, the both ends of low smoke and zero halogen sheath 1 all are provided with sealed port 2, and the inner wall of sealed port 2 closely laminates with fireproof cable's outer wall, and sealed port 2 that the both ends of low smoke and zero halogen sheath 1 all set up plays the effect that strengthens 1 both ends sealing performance of low smoke and zero halogen sheath, thereby sealed port 2's inner wall closely laminates with fireproof cable's outer wall and makes low smoke and zero halogen sheath 1 seal completely to the cable.
The working principle is as follows: during the use, adopt the prefabricated cable joint of mill, cable joint adopts installation insulating sheath 5 outward, insulating sheath 5 fills fire prevention mud 6 outward, outermost crowded package low smoke and zero halogen sheath 1 of moulding plastics reaches the purpose of sealing and insulating to fireproof cable joint department, the cable joint parcel back that finishes, install low smoke and zero halogen sheath 1 into the inside interface channel 9 of loading board 3, compress tightly work to low smoke and zero halogen sheath 1 through a plurality of pressure spring 11 on the interface channel 9 inner wall, then aim at near wall or the ground of the near installation site with base 4 of loading board 3 lower extreme, make bottom plate 13 and wall or ground contact, through the internally mounted expansion bolt at mounting hole 14 with bottom plate 13 and wall or ground fixed mounting, accomplish fireproof cable joint's installation work.
